#da52ef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#da52ef is composed of 85.5% red, 32.2% green and 93.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.8% cyan, 65.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 292 degrees, a saturation of 83.1% and a lightness of 62.9%. #da52ef color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a4ff with #b500df.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

#da52ef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#da52ef has RGB values of R:218, G:82, B:239 and CMYK values of C:0.09, M:0.66, Y:0,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 14308079.

Shades and Tints of #da52ef
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060107 is the darkest color, while #fdf4f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#da52ef
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a59ba6 is the less saturated color, while #e543fe is the most saturated one.
